Bernie,
I don't know if this King is connected to Peggy's or not.
This man is a decendant of Thomas Jefferson "Jeff" King from KY.
This King family came to Baxter County area after 1900 I believe.
I know Jeff was in the Civil War and in 1913 at age 78 he married my gr gr
aunt. His wife Rachel (Lawson) died. I only know of two children Bess & J.
D., senior. I haven't been able to find an obit for him or his wife Rachel.
I know he is buried by his wife Rachel and my gr gr aunt moved to KY after
he died. I was told she went to the area where he came from.
These King graves are on a little family cemetery in a cow pasture under a
little group of trees. I fwas shown it a few years ago. The owner of the
property has had little cement makers made for some of the unmarked graves
and is trying to clean the cemetery up. I regret that I didn't take
pictures. Another gr aunt is kin to the Lawsons buried here.
